Cosmos is an experimental, algorithmic/convolution hybrid reverb plugin derived from a massive "Klangfeld" tuned metal plate recording session. Unlike traditional reverbs, Cosmos adds harmonic content, ghostly pitches, and evolving metallic decays. Ideal for sound design, cinematic textures, ambient music, and drum destruction.
